He says his goal is to \u201cactually articulate the choice that\u2019s in front of voters in a way that Ken Paxton has never had to face.\u201d\u00a0<\/p>\n<div>\n<div>\n<div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<p>\n\tWhile Paxton has served three terms as Texas\u2019 chief legal officer, he has yet to be electorally tested since Republicans in the state legislature impeached him in 2023, on 20 articles including bribery, alleged corruption, abuse of office in his dealings with Texas real estate developer Nate Paul, retaliation against whistleblowers, and obstruction of justice. Paxton was acquitted by the Texas Senate, shortly after a Super PAC aligned with the attorney general donated and \u201cloaned\u201d $3 million to the campaign coffers of Lieutenant Governor Dan Patrick, who also happens to serve as the president of the Senate presiding officer over the impeachment.\u00a0\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\tPaxton has also been criminally indicted, on charges of fraud by the Securities and Exchange Commission. The feds alleged that the attorney general, at the time a state lawmaker, had tricked investors (and at least one Texas lawmaker) into buying stock in a tech firm without disclosing his own kickback arrangement with the company. The case hung over Paxton for nine years, delayed by venue disputes and other technicalities, before being dropped after he agreed to pay out $271,000 in restitution, perform 100 hours of community service, and take an ethics course.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\tIn July of last year, Paxton\u2019s scandals and repeated instances of infidelity apparently became too much for his wife \u2014 state Senator Angela Paxton \u2014 who filed for divorce. Mrs. Paxton wrote in her announcement that she was separating from her husband on \u201cbiblical grounds,\u201d and adding that \u201cin light of recent discoveries,\u201d she did not\u00a0believe \u201cthat it honors God or is loving to myself, my children, or Ken to remain in the marriage.\u201d Their divorce trial was slated for later this month, but was recently canceled after they agreed \u201ca trial setting is no longer necessary.\u201d\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\tPaxton has managed to maneuver himself out of seemingly every possible roadblock. Paxton\u2019s first post-runoff ad highlighted Talarico\u2019s support for transgender rights, immigration reform, and climate change, ending with an image of Trump and Paxton and a voiceover reminding the audience that \u201cthis is Texas,\u201d before flipping to an image of Talarico and declaring that \u201cthis is not.\u201d<\/p>\n<div>\n<div>\n<div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<p>\n\tTalarico\u2019s first post-runoff ad targeting his opponent, meanwhile, highlighted a sweetheart plea deal he gave to Adam Hoffman, a man who admitted to molesting a young boy over a period of three years \u2014 an attempt to contrast Paxton\u2019s \u201ctough on crime\u201d rhetoric with his actual record as Texas\u2019 attorney general.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\tTalarico\u00a0wants to avoid mentioning Trump and force Paxton to campaign as himself not just because Paxton\u2019s record is bad enough on its own, but because he\u2019s never really been tested as a candidate. The attorney general historically benefited from cruising to the Republican nomination and never having to actually campaign to win an election. There are two critical exceptions. The first took place in 2018 when, amid a criminal indictment for fraud that Paxton later settled, he barely won reelection by three points over his Democratic challenger. The second came just a few months ago, when Paxton narrowly lost the Republican primary vote to Cornyn, but managed to force a runoff since neither candidate won an outright majority. To Talarico, it\u2019s a sign that the attorney general\u2019s ground is far less stable than he\u2019d like voters to think.\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\t\u201cKen Paxton has never been up for election since he was impeached by his own party,\u201d Talarico explains. Like how do we actually elect leaders who are going to fight for us, who are going to fight to unrig this economy?\u201d\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>\n\tYet the circumstances in which Trump took back the White House are necessary context to understand the current electoral landscape in the state. Trump made a series of historic gains among Hispanic and Black voters. In Texas, border counties that had not elected a Republican president in over a century were suddenly tinged red. It looked like a potentially lethal blow to state Democrats, until Trump actually took office. Tariff wars, hardline immigration enforcement, and rampant corruption have seen the president\u2019s progress among Hispanics all but completely wiped out. The oil and gas shock caused by Trump\u2019s war against Iran is pummeling the freight-heavy, car-centric state. The consequences of MAGA governance are coming home to roost. It\u2019s now a matter of Texans taking to the polls.<\/p>\n<div>\n<div>\n<div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<p>\n\tLast Friday, as San Antonio prepared for a winner-take-all Western Conference Finals Game 7, hundreds of Talarico\u2019s supporters queued up outside of Paper Tiger, a local music hall just off of the city\u2019s historic Pearl District.
